Output 62ccb470cec04b8396f1a0bb8e8acd44060563540f05e07390e50399af23130c:2

value
30621886
script pubkey
OP_0 OP_PUSHBYTES_20 3d1997023dfc69677528970e5d9846ce51e7119c
address
bc1q85vewq3al35kwafgju89mxzxeeg7wyvu0mnf9c
transaction
62ccb470cec04b8396f1a0bb8e8acd44060563540f05e07390e50399af23130c
spent
true